Store Manager
It was pretty straightforward. I met with two Account Executives, and after that, I got the green light. I learned a lot about the company's needs, culture, and what they're looking for. Each AE focused on different qualities to see if I'd be a good fit. Once they both agreed, the Retailer contacted me to come in and finish the paperwork.
